We need technological solutions to undo the damage we've done to the climate. Trees won't sequeseter CO₂ fast enough by themselves. We need ideological solutions, so that people don't cancel the gains of technological solutions with increased growth and waste. And then we need political/economic solutions like carbon tax to redirect money towards technological solutions, and minds towards ideological and lifestyle ones.
Really, we shouldn't be fighting over which kind of solution we need, because neither is sufficient in isolation. We need them all. Let's focus instead on fighting opposition to any and all effective solutions for saving people.
